Uk English Meaning of duvet
duvet
Other Uk English words related to duvet
No Synonyms and anytonyms found
Nearest Words of duvet
Definitions and Meaning of duvet in English
duvet (n)
a soft quilt usually filled with the down of the eider
FAQs About the word duvet
duvet
a soft quilt usually filled with the down of the eider
No synonyms found.
No antonyms found.
duvalier => Duvalier, duumvirs => duumvirs, duumviri => Duumviri, duumvirate => duumvirate, duumviral => duumviral,